The Center for Autism (EIN: 23-1728027)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, The Center for Autism,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 out of 182 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$620,897. The highest compensated employee at The Center for Autism is Richard Cohen with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$1,650,677.

Mission Statement
THE CENTER FOR AUTISM IS A NONPROFIT AGENCY FORMED TO OFFER A COMPREHENSIVE SPECTRUM OF PROGRAMS & SERVICES TO MEET THE NEEDS OF INDIVIDUALS WITH AUTISM SPECTRUM DISORDERS AND THEIR FAMILIES.
